A couple of tricks:

To indent a line, start it with a colon.
Two colons indents further.

If you start line with a space, you get a fixed-width font inside a box

like this.

(Hit "edit this page" to see how I made these.)

Reminder to use the Edit Summary edit

Regarding your edits to the Diaper page: I have noticed that you often edit without an edit summary. Please do your best to always fill in the summary field. This is considered an important guideline in Wikipedia. Even a short summary is better than no summary. An edit summary is even more important if you delete any text; otherwise, people may think you're being sneaky. Also, mentioning one change but not another one can be misleading to someone who finds the other one more important; add "and misc." to cover the other change(s).
